I'm gonna start by using Rome apples,
0:30
and I'm gonna squeeze about
0:33
a tablespoon of lemon juice over them
0:36
to just keep them from turning dark.
0:39
And I'm gonna use about 3/4 a cup of sugar,
0:46
and to that we're gonna add one tablespoon of flour,
0:54
and some ground cinnamon.
0:58
And we're just gonna stir that up.

Okay, now, we're gonna put a lattice crust on this pie,
2:32
and it's so very simple.
2:34
We're gonna take an extra round of dough.
2:37
Now this is on parchment paper so it won't stick on me.
2:40
Now I'm gonna take my knife,
2:42
and I'm gonna run it down into my flour,
2:44
so the dough won't stick to our knife.
2:49
I'm just gonna cut us some strips.
2:51
Now if you like wide lattice, you can cut them wide.
2:55
If you like a narrow lattice, you can cut them more narrow.
2:59
All right, so we're gonna start
3:01
with the outside of our circle.
3:03
And I'm gonna use five strips.
3:06
Now latticing is very, very simple.
3:10
I'm gonna pull every other strip back,
3:13
and lay a piece of crust in there,
3:15
and then fold that back over.
3:17
So you see I've got three strips under, two strips over.
3:22
All I'm gonna do now is take
3:23
the three strips that are under,
3:28
and come in there with another piece.
3:30
Bring them back over,
3:31
and then do the same thing again with another strip.
3:35
It looks like it might be hard, but it's not at all.
3:39
And we have a latticed pie crust.
3:42
Now I'm gonna come in and just take the edges
3:45
and trim them up to fit our plate.
3:47
Now before we put that in the oven,
3:49
we are gonna make a crunch topping for it.
3:52
It's very, very simple to do.
3:54
We're gonna take some flour,
3:58
some sugar, and just a pinch of salt,
4:05
and then we're gonna cut in some butter.
4:07
Then till it's kind of crumbly,
4:09
just like we were making biscuits.
4:13
And then we're gonna come over here,
4:15
and just sprinkle this on top of our pie.
4:18
All right, now we're gonna slip this into the over
4:20
which has been preheated to 425 degrees.
4:23
We're gonna let it bake for about 10 minutes,
4:25
and then we're gonna lower the temperature to 350.

I'm wanna tell you how Southerners love their apple pie.
5:01
When I was a little girl and my mother would make apple pies
5:04
she would always pull out the cheddar cheese, grate that,
5:08
put it on top of the slice of apple pie,
5:10
and run it under the broiler.
5:12
And we would have cheese topped apple pie
5:16
that was so delicious.
